UK economy grew by 0.1% in May despite impact of Iran war
The Office for National Statistics said the UK economy grew 0.1% in May, in line with economists’ forecasts, after a 0.1% decline in April.
Dunelm Q4 sales grew 2.9% to £428m after strong demand for its summer ranges helped offset a drop in store footfall during June’s extreme heat.
Frasers scraps profit guidance
Frasers Group has withheld its profit guidance for the year ahead as its multibillion-pound pursuit of Hugo Boss and Accent Group creates uncertainty over its financial outlook.
DFS sees strong financial performance for the year
DFS trading update to 28 June 2026 shows full year underlying profit before tax and brand amortisation is expected to be about £45m, up approximately £15m year-on-year.
Shoe Zone update delivers much-needed good news
Shoe Zone has revised its forecast for the year and now expects its adjusted loss before tax to be no greater than £1m, down from a previous forecast of a £1-2m loss.
Ted Baker says standalone stores are coming ‘very soon’
The owner of Ted Baker has said the fashion brand will open its first standalone store later this year as it works on rebuilding its brick-and-mortar estate.
Stripe, Advent offer to buy PayPal for more than $53bn
Stripe and private equity firm Advent International have made a joint offer to acquire PayPal for $60.50 per share, valuing the company at more than $53bn.
Ocado boss Steiner ‘energised about future’ despite succession battle
Ocado boss Tim Steiner has insisted he is “as excited and energised” about the firm’s future following a battle over his succession which will see him depart in around 18 months.
BRC calls on Andy Burnham to back manifesto for jobs, growth and affordability
The British Retail Consortium has launched its Buy into Retail Manifesto, which calls on Andy Burnham to support reforms to employment costs, business rates, energy and regulation.
Burberry quashes investor revolt
The majority of Burberry investors voted in support of CEO Joshua Schulman’s controversial increase in share awards if performance and share price targets are met.
Uber launches €13bn Delivery Hero takeover
Uber has launched a €13bn (£11.3bn) takeover bid for Delivery Hero as it looks to dramatically expand its food delivery and rapid grocery operations around the world.
The top reasons why people think high streets are in decline
The ACS Community Barometer 2026 found empty shop units (63%) and a poor range of shops and services (53%) are the biggest reasons why people think high streets are in decline.

New BNPL rules trigger major checkout shake-up for retailers
Retailers are bracing for changes to their online checkout journeys as the UK’s new buy now, pay later (BNPL) regulations come into force today.
Many UK high street retailers suffering from AI chatbot inaccuracies
ChatGPT, Google's Gemini, and Perplexity chatbots are delivering false results up to 10% of the time for queries on a retailer's brand identity, contact details, and location.
Price beats ethics at the checkout
Over two-thirds (68%) say ethical production matters to them, but when it came to their last actual purchase, the single most common behaviour was to buy based on price or quality alone.
Fashion e-tail parcel volumes fall
Scurri’s latest ‘Ecommerce Delivery Index’ found overall parcel volumes grew by 0.2% year-on-year between April and June, but fashion deliveries fell 14%.
The Very Group turns to AI to overhaul pricing strategy
The Very Group has launched an AI-powered pricing system across its retail brands, as part of a new three-year partnership with software company UiPath.
Asda adds allergen warnings to shelf labels across 142 Express stores
Asda has rolled out allergen, ingredient and calorie information on electronic shelf-edge labels across 142 of its convenience stores.

Summer is here! So keep on adding anything summer-related to your media centres, eg summer clothing, swimwear, bikinis, shorts, beachwear, sunglasses, plus things to keep you cool, like fans, sun hats and sun shades. Also, push anything to do with the outside, such as garden furniture, anything for a garden party, or a picnic or barbecue, and don’t forget to add all of the other spellings that people may search on eg BBQ, Bar-B-Que, etc and other related keywords like picnic.
The festival season is now in full-swing, and the media are all looking for festival wear and things to take to festivals (tents, fans, ice boxes, torches, etc). We’re also getting ready to go on holiday, so luggage, bags, bumbags, beach towels, etc are all being searched for.
Also, look at any sports-related items, as this month sees the end of football’s World Cup Finals in the US/Mexico/Canada. Plus, look at anything tennis-related for Wimbledon, which is on for the first weeks of July, so anything football or tennis-related should be flagged and plus it's the Tour de France so anything lycra-related might also be good to flag.
Other clothing keywords being searched for this summer include; denim, florals, crochet, midi-dresses, maxi-dresses, polo, preppy, tennis-core and festival wear.
But not everyone is going abroad. The cost-of-living crisis is still cutting-into everyone’s wallets, so shoppers are still looking at holidays closer to home. Add in keywords and phrases like “staycation”, “holistay”, “holiday at home” to your keywords and why not suggest clothing like raincoats, coats, hoodies, and cardigans? If you stock them, then firepits and chimineas for the colder UK evenings would be good to add.
